Output 83523c673151fc44fa0baa25e9823b5d1417aa84b37255299235ab28eb209c55:0

value
1628000
script pubkey
OP_0 OP_PUSHBYTES_20 6ab941c3fa48e59ab8eeeb0390bc035623d5a536
address
bc1qd2u5rsl6frje4w8wavpep0qr2c3atffkaxjh0x
transaction
83523c673151fc44fa0baa25e9823b5d1417aa84b37255299235ab28eb209c55
spent
true